Hmm, not much going on here. A build your own section along the back wall with some local and regional brews and foreign stuff like Kirin Ichiban. Small wall of six pack and expensive beers of the world sampler packs. Unibroue, rogue and dogfish head seemed about the best they had to offer. Don’t go out of your way, at least for the beer. Foods from around the world may be more interesting, same goes for the wines. The best thing about this store is that Steve and Barry’s sits underneath it, cheap Wisconsin and other college apparel aplenty.

I’m really not sure why this is on here. It’s a very nice store with cool multicultural-influenced furniture and foods. There was a decent selection of beer with a bunch available in make-your-own sixers, the New Glarus fruit beers, Rogue stuff, and some imports.. but nothing you can’t find in a decent area liquor store (and this store is more expensive). There WAS a decent selection of about 20 different sakes, and those appeard to be reasonably priced. I would never stop here for beer.

Perhaps one of the more well known "make your own six pack” places; however, their selection isn’t very good - Sierra Nevada, Bells, New Holland, Anchor and Paulaner were most of what you’re dealing with. You can get those and more, for a better price, at Breeze-Thru in Milwaukee on Bluemound. Plus, the pricing at World Market isn’t very good. Bottles are priced individually and there’s no price break for building your six pack. They do have nice six-pack cartons, so grab one of those for the hell of it. They do sell a bunch of glassware for reasonable prices, and have a lot of wine, salsas and hot sauces from around the world. All in all, nice store, but not for beer.
